Job Description

The district governments PASS Modernization Project is replacing the existing on-premises procurement management system with a new state-of-the-art cloud solution. The client seeks a Project Manager to support the Project Management Office (PMO) by managing the development of reporting and analytics to include:

  • Development of reporting and analytics requirements
  • Development of alternative solutions that meet the requirements
  • Identification of the best solutions
  • Identification of data sources for the best solutions
  • Implementation of the best solutions including documentation
  • Testing of the solutions
  • Post go-live support

Responsibilities include:

Project Planning Activities

  • Develop maintain and monitor project schedules (status/progress)
  • Create and maintain project documents
  • Coordinate submissions of workstream weekly status reports
  • Develop PMO status reports
  • Prepare status presentations using Microsoft PowerPoint
  • Report status to PMO project leadership and organization leadership
  • Organize project artifacts in Microsoft Teams

Data Reporting and Analytics Strategy

  • Develop strategies and project plans that align with client and District goals
  • Coordinate stakeholder engagement to understand vision and goals for reports and analytics
  • Work with PMO and other project managers to ensure team members have the knowledge and skills to support stakeholders
  • Coordinate the use of data from reports and analytics to support business decisions incorporating these into training materials policies and procedures

Project Vision and Planning

  • Translate the projects data reporting and analytics vision into long- and short-range plans including:
  • Project plans
  • Resource alignments
  • Training and communications
  • Transformation and change management
  • System integration testing
  • User acceptance testing
  • Go-live preparations
  • Post-go-live support

Workstream Coordination

  • Balance multiple priorities while coordinating resources
  • Monitor activities to maintain PMO schedule and update as necessary
  • Coordinate with PMO to mitigate impacts to other workstreams

Leverage Prior Experience

  • Analyze complex delivery dates to create innovative Microsoft Project schedules or Agile Scrum Roadmap Timebox schedules
  • Align schedules with organizations stakeholder groups functional workstreams technology methodology tools and solution components
  • Monitor progress to track milestones and report on progress

Oversight and Analysis

  • Manage project scope and objectives including RAID (Risks Actions Issues Decisions) change management and communications processes
  • Provide quality organization and oversight for all project documents
  • Maintain project artifacts in Microsoft Teams and SharePoint

Meetings and Communication

  • Participate in PMO Steering Committee and other project meetings
  • Document discussions and decisions
  • Serve as liaison between PMO other project managers and team members
  • Support PMO for all aspects of the project
